Output 3aaf7035000e8cac8d951a88892642b373687f24d0c7e10c633d27b472bf8421:0

value
226969
script pubkey
OP_0 OP_PUSHBYTES_20 1920532039882ea61136688ee768c133487f9ae1
address
bc1qrys9xgpe3qh2vyfkdz8ww6xpxdy8lxhplhej0w
transaction
3aaf7035000e8cac8d951a88892642b373687f24d0c7e10c633d27b472bf8421
confirmations
74319
spent
true